Accountants to Circle Cornwall for NSPCC
The staff at one of Cornwall's leading businesses will be raising money for the NSPCC by walking the entire Cornish coastal footpath - all 258 miles of it - in a single day.
Leading accountancy and financial services firm Kelsall Steele celebrates its sixtieth birthday this year, and to mark the occasion 60+ staff will be taking part in the Cornish Coastal Footpath Challenge on Sunday 18 June, cheered on by family, friends and clients.
Each member of the firm is aiming to raise £100, and will walk one stretch of the coastal path, choosing one of 62 individual walks ranging from three to six miles and graded according to level of difficulty.
All the money raised will go towards publishing We Wish, a book of stories and poems by children from Cornwall's primary schools, produced with the help of staff and students at University College Falmouth to be sold in aid of the NSPCC.
Mike Hutchinson, Director of Kelsall Steele, said: "We wanted to do something that embraces the whole of Cornwall and reflects our presence in the county - our client base literally stretches from coast to coast. When the NSPCC told us about the We Wish project we saw it as a really imaginative way of supporting a great cause, bringing together hundreds of children and students across Cornwall to produce a book of lasting value. By helping to cover the production costs, we at Kelsall Steele can make sure that the book raises a really substantial amount to support the NSPCC's work with vulnerable children."
Sandra Myers, West Cornwall organiser for the NSPCC, said: "We're thrilled to have Kelsall Steele's support for this exciting project. Raising money for charity should be enjoyable - and children from over 40 schools in Cornwall have already had tremendous fun writing their pieces for the book. I hope that everyone at Kelsall Steele enjoys doing their bit on the 18th, and I'm very much looking forward to joining them on the walk."
